Overview
BS EN 1083-2:1997 outlines the safety requirements for power-driven brushes used in various manufacturing processes. This standard is crucial for ensuring that equipment operates safely and efficiently, thereby protecting operators and maintaining compliance with regulatory frameworks.
Key Requirements
The standard specifies essential safety measures that manufacturers must implement when designing and using power-driven brushes. Key requirements include:
- Design Safety: Equipment must be designed to minimise risks associated with mechanical hazards, including entanglement and contact with moving parts.
- Operational Safety: Clear operational guidelines must be established to ensure safe use, including proper training for operators.
- Maintenance Protocols: Regular maintenance schedules should be defined to ensure that brushes remain in safe working condition.
- Noise and Vibration Control: Measures should be taken to limit noise and vibration exposure to operators, in line with health regulations.
